Basic education, experience and skills required for consideration:

  • BSN or BS/BA in related/complementary field required.  A background in a related field such as medical technology, blood banking, or quality management with appropriate experience may substitute for the education requirement with VP approval.
  • Content expert in quality improvement concepts plus minimum of 5-7 years of nursing and/or health care leadership experience.
  • One to two years of quality improvement experience, to include consultation or direct work in process improvement or rapid cycle improvement, systems thinking concepts, team facilitation, performance measurement and/or stratification of data.
  • An ideal candidate will have experience in Clinical Hematology/Hematopoietic Cellular Therapy Transfusion medicine services or solid organ transplant program.
  • Content expert in quality improvement concepts, ongoing education and training related to the field of cellular therapy and quality management (FACT standard and CIBMTR requirements).
  • Requires strong interpersonal and facilitation skills to work effectively with HCT program members from multiple organizations, to include leading meetings, coordinating program activities such as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) development, and negotiating differences of opinion regarding program direction.
  • Requires proficiency in data analysis required by both internal and external reporting (e.g. accreditation and payer networks).
  • Independent judgment, analytical ability to problem solve, make decisions, formulate reports, perform statistical analysis and interpret data, create and monitor work plans (e.g. in preparation for accreditation surveys), prioritize workload, and meet deadlines.
  • Strong writing skills to support accreditation, SOP development, and other quality-related responsibilities.
  • Ability to take action on quality issues while challenging the existing systems.
  • Knowledgeable of federal, state, local and other accreditation/regulatory requirements.
  • Microsoft Office, Excel QI Macro, Visio and other organizational software as appropriate to duties.
   

Preferred education experience and skills:

  • Master’s Degree in Nursing or in related/complementary field.
  • Experience in an accredited Hematopoietic Cellular Therapy/Transplant Program or solid organ transplant program. 
  • Database development or experience
  • Quality Management related courses.
  • CPHQ (Certified Professional in Heath care Quality), CPHM (Certified Professional in Healthcare Management), Medical technologist ASCP or equivalent as applicable.
